Which of the following is a commonly used approach in substance abuse treatment?
Acupuncture
Prayer
Hypnosis
Detoxification
The Correct Answer is D
A. Acupuncture: While it may be used as a complementary therapy, it is not a primary approach.
B. Prayer: This may provide personal comfort but is not a medical treatment.
C. Hypnosis: Hypnosis is not widely used or validated for substance abuse treatment.
D. Detoxification: Detoxification is the process of safely removing a substance from the body, often under medical supervision.
